How much is a round-trip flight from Istanbul Airport to Lisbon?

This analysis is based on the cheapest round-trip price found on KAYAK in the last 12 months by searching for a flight from Istanbul Airport to Lisbon departing in January.

Flight prices are below average for this route right now.

Flights to Lisbon from Istanbul Airport usually cost between $552 and $889 in January.
The lowest price found in the past 5 days was $184 on Sky Express (Jan 20-Jan 27).

What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Istanbul to Lisbon?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Istanbul Airport to Lisbon cl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

When flying from Istanbul to Lisbon, you should consider leaving on a Friday and avoid Sundays if you are looking for the best rates. For your return to Istanbul, you’ll find the best rates on Thursdays and the most expensive ones on Saturdays.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Istanbul Airport to Lisbon?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Istanbul Airport to Lisbon,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Istanbul Airport to Lisbon is October, where tickets cost $440 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are August and July,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$759 and $583 respectively.

Can I save money by flying with a layover from Istanbul Airport to Lisbon?

The average round-trip price for all non-stop flights, flights with one layover, and flights with two layovers for the route found by users searching on KAYAK in the last 2 weeks.

No, with an average price for the route of $795, prices are generally cheapest when you fly direct.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Istanbul Airport to Lisbon?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Istanbul Airport to Lisbon,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Istanbul Airport to Lisbon, you should book around 6 weeks before departure, which saves you about 61%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 13 weeks before departure.

FAQs for booking Istanbul to Lisbon flights

  • What is the cheapest flight from Istanbul Airport to Lisbon?

    In the last 5 days, the lowest price for a flight from Istanbul Airport to Lisbon was $104 for a one-way ticket and $184 for a round-trip.

  • Do I need a passport to fly between Istanbul and Lisbon?

    A passport is required to fly from Istanbul to Lisbon.

  • Which airports will I be using when flying from Istanbul to Lisbon?

    Istanbul airport is called Istanbul and the only airport in Lisbon is Lisbon Humberto Delgado.

  • Which aircraft models fly most regularly from Istanbul to Lisbon?

    The Airbus A321neo is the aircraft model that flies most regularly on the Istanbul to Lisbon flight route.

  • Which airline alliances offer flights from Istanbul to Lisbon?

    Star Alliance is the only airline alliance operating flights between Istanbul and Lisbon.

  • On which days can I fly direct from Istanbul to Lisbon?

    There are nonstop flights from Istanbul to Lisbon on a daily basis.

  • Which is the best airline for flights from Istanbul to Lisbon, Turkish Airlines or Pegasus Airlines?

    The two airlines most popular with KAYAK users for flights from Istanbul to Lisbon are Turkish Airlines and Pegasus Airlines. With an average price for the route of $536 and an overall rating of 7.4, Turkish Airlines is the most popular choice. Pegasus Airlines is also a great choice for the route, with an average price of $258 and an overall rating of 6.6.

This flight was in the air when the national power outage happened on 28 April 2025 in Spain and Portugal. As a result Lisbon airport was closed and the flight was diverted to Porto. There were no phones, internet or ATMs working and the Turkish Airlines ground crew in Porto were trying to find alternative transport to Lisbon (by bus). This did not materialise until late in the evening. The Turkish Airlines ground crew suggested that passengers may find their own way of getting to Lisbon. That in itself is a failure of Turkish Airlines, but understandable as there were no means of communication. The Turkish Airlines ground crew also said that any expenses insured for travel to Lisbon will be refunded by the Airline through their website. Unfortunately, I could find no way to travel back to Lisbon other than to hitch hike with an Uber driver. Because no systems were available and no credit card payment possible I paid the driver 140 Euros in cash with no receipt as systems were down. I arrived at my Lisbon hotel at 23:30 (flight was scheduled to land at 12:30). Upon contacting Turkish Airlines for compensation they are not willing to do anything as I do not have an invoice for my expenses. They do not even consider the 10 hours of delay and inactivity on their part as a reason to provide any sort of curtesy towards me. I find their behaviour appalling.
